Skip to content

rahulb246/MiniFacebook

Repository files navigation

MiniFacebook

Concepts Used: Graphs, Trie, File Handling, Command Line Arguments

Description: A console based C Program where some Facebook features are implemented: 1.take new users and map their friends details 2.store the users and their friendships(in the file) 3.list out all the friends of a user 4.list out mutual friends of any two friends 5.LINKEDIN feature ‘how you are connected’ (showing the path of connections how two users are connected).

Every feature is implemented very efficiently using the right and effective datastructures. For example, Trie data structure is used hold over 1 lakh users so that time required for finding any username will be O(length(username)).

About

No description, website, or topics provided.

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Languages